First method is using facts. They are simply statements of what is. Facts should appeal to the reader’s mind, not just to the emotions. The source of the writer’s facts should be clear to the reader. To do not make the reader justifiably suspicious of writer’s “facts” he or she has to avoid the vague such as: “everyone knows that” or “it is common knowledge that”. Second method is referring to an authority. An authority is an expert, someone who can be relied on to give unbiased facts and information. The writer has to avoid appealing to “authorities” who are interesting but who are not experts. Another method for persuasion is using examples. The example should clearly relate to the argument and should be typical enough to support it. Avoiding examples that are not typical enough to support the general statement, it is a good way. To persuade the reader, the writer can use the method predicting the consequence. It helps the reader to visualize what will occur if something does or does not happen. For this method the writer has to avoid exaggerating the consequence. Answering the opposition is the last method which shows that the writer is aware of the opposition’s argument and is able to respond to it. it is a tip for this method to attack the opposition’s ideas, not their character.
